A vegetable stew of eggplant, zucchini, bell peppers, and tomatoes simmered with herbs and wine. Warm, savory, and adaptable—served hot or cold, plain or topped with a fried egg and crusty bread.

Ingredients
serves 6- 1 pounds eggplant, (peeled (or striped) and cut into 1-inch pieces)
- Kosher salt
- Extra virgin olive oil
- 1 yellow onion, (finely chopped)
- 2 bell peppers (mix of red, green, or yellow), (sliced into 1-inch pieces)
- 6 garlic cloves, (minced)
- 2 pounds tomatoes, (chopped)
- 2 zucchini, (sliced into 1/2-inch half moons)
- 1/2 cup red wine
- 2 sprigs fresh thyme
- 1 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 teaspoon sweet paprika
- 1 teaspoon dried rosemary
- 1 tablespoon sherry vinegar
- 3 tablespoons chopped fresh basil
